Both are about the tragedy of the deposed king. The Princess's Man could be considered an introduction to the downfall of King Dan Jong and the rise of his uncle, Prince Su Yang, who is the main villain of the drama.

However, while the political timeline in The Princess's Man is accurate historically, it focuses on a fictional romance between Prince Su Yang's daughter and the son of his political rival.
